Kinds of Fireplaces
When thinking about a new fireplace, homebuyers will find several types to pick from. Each type comes with its own distinct functions, benefits, and disadvantages. Below is a breakdown of typical fireplace Styles types:
Fireplace TypeDescriptionProsConsWood-BurningTraditional alternative utilizing logs for fuel.Authentic experience, strong heat source.Needs routine maintenance, fuel storage, and ventilation.GasUses gas or propane, usually with a vented or ventless option.Easy to utilize, less upkeep than wood.Requires a gas line, may lose some atmosphere.ElectricPlug-and-play options without any need for venting, supplying simulated flames.No installation required, safe for houses.Does not have the credibility of real flames.EthanolUses bio-ethanol fuel in a portable or set unit.Tidy burning, no venting required.More costly fuel costs, restricted heat output.PelletBurns compressed wood pellets for fuel, similar to wood-burning.Eco-friendly, low emissions.Requires electrical energy for operation, specific fuel needed.Key Considerations When Buying a Fireplace1. To make sure longevity and ideal efficiency of your fireplace, routine upkeep is essential. Here are some suggestions to keep your fireplace in fantastic shape:
Wood-Burning FireplacesTidy the chimney a minimum of as soon as a year to prevent creosote accumulation.Use skilled wood for less smoke and better effectiveness.Inspect the fireplace structure for fractures or wear and tear.Gas FireplacesCheck gas connections for leaks regularly.Clean the glass and the burner for optimal performance.Arrange yearly maintenance with a certified professional.Electric FireplacesDust and tidy the unit regularly.Examine connections and replace any defective parts if needed.Make sure the system is sparkling tidy before use each season.Ethanol and Pellet FireplacesKeep fuel sources kept safely and far from heat.Tidy the burner and make sure no blockages take place.FAQs
Q: What type of fireplace is most efficient for heating?A: Gas elegant fireplaces and
pellet stoves tend to have higher effectiveness, transforming more energy to heat compared to wood-burning alternatives.
Q: Can I install a fireplace in any room?A: While lots of spaces can accommodate a fireplace, ventilation, available area, and local regulations may affect feasibility.
Q: Are electric fireplaces safe?A: Yes,
electric fireplaces are typically extremely safe, consist of no genuine flames, and often include functions that prevent getting too hot.
